Transaction efbb170a76ae96417fc8705596a8ff40853d7afcd0a8450fe65eb88827495fed

block
8f075713be4afdcf28c3e41fa7f34f5df5feff02c5ae1158b2d87a806ac460c6

1 Input

3 Outputs